About Neutrik Cable NBNC75BTU-11 Female Contactor
The rearTWIST HD BNC cable connector offers a true 75 ohm design and is perfectly suitable for HD applications.The patented rearTWIST boot guarantees easy access even in high density applications and offers color coding.
Suitable cables:Belden 1694A (ANH), Belden 4694R, Bryant BD SD11, Canare L-4.5CHD, Clark Wire CD7506-0, CommScope 5765, Gepco VSD2001, Suhner S05163-02, Suhner S05133-07, Percon VK77
Crimp size:Pin: 1.6 mm (square)Shield: 7.36 mm (hex)
Reliable Performance in Broadcast ApplicationsDesigned for demanding professional environments, the NBNC75BTU-11 ensures uninterrupted high-definition video transmission. The combination of gold-plated contacts and precise impedance control reduces signal degradation, making it ideal for studios, control rooms, and on-site broadcasting. This connector is specifically tailored for 75 coaxial cables, supporting broadcast-grade standards.
User-Friendly Push/Pull Locking MechanismFeaturing a secure push/pull BNC locking system, the connector enables quick and reliable mating and unmating. Its cable mount and crimp sleeve termination simplify the installation process, reducing setup time while providing long-lasting cable connections. The robust construction is designed to withstand rigorous use in professional environments.
Exceptional Durability and ComplianceThe NBNC75BTU-11 is crafted from high-quality materials like machined brass and PTFE insulation, offering excellent electrical and mechanical properties. With an ingress protection of IP40 and compliance with RoHS standards, this connector is safe and environmentally friendly for both indoor and controlled outdoor environments.
FAQs of Neutrik Cable NBNC75BTU-11 Female Contactor:
Q: How do I install the Neutrik NBNC75BTU-11 cable mount BNC connector?
A: The NBNC75BTU-11 is designed for cable mount installation with crimp sleeve termination. Simply strip the coaxial cable as per manufacturer guidelines, insert it into the connector, and use the appropriate crimping tool to secure the sleeve. The push/pull locking mechanism ensures a fast and secure connection.
Q: What types of cables are compatible with this connector?
A: This connector is compatible with 75 coaxial cables up to 6 mm outer diameter. The jacket and shield materials should match the coaxial cable specifications for optimal performance in professional video transmission applications.
Q: When should I use this connector in my setup?
A: Use the NBNC75BTU-11 when reliable SDI, HDTV, or digital video transmission is required, especially in professional broadcast studios, patch panels, or field installations where signal integrity is critical.

Q: What is the benefit of the gold-plated center contact in this connector?
A: The gold-plated center contact offers excellent conductivity and corrosion resistance, reducing signal loss and ensuring stable performance even after repeated connections and disconnections.
Q: How does the push/pull locking mechanism enhance usability?
A: The push/pull locking mechanism enables quick, secure, and tool-free mating and release of the connector, making it highly efficient for frequent patching or reconfiguration in dynamic studio environments.
